K. K. Hof- und Staatsdruckerei, Otto Barth, Wocheiner Bahn, lithograph, total: height: 104 cm; width: 66, 4 cm, signed: bottom left in the stone: OTTO BARTH, product and business advertising (posters), tourism posters, landscapes, waters, city view, railroad traffic, hist. building, locality, street, river
